فيديو: ما هوIdentity في SQL؟
2024 مؤلف: Lynn Donovan | [email protected]. آخر تعديل: 2023-12-15 23:43
SQL الخادم هوية . هوية عمود الجدول هو عمود تزيد قيمته تلقائيًا. القيمة في ملف هوية العمود تم إنشاؤه بواسطة الخادم. لا يمكن للمستخدم عمومًا إدراج قيمة في ملف هوية عمودي. هوية يمكن استخدام العمود لتعريف الصفوف في الجدول بشكل فريد.
وفقًا لذلك ، ما هوIdentity في SQL Server؟
أ معرف خادم SQL العمود هو نوع خاص من الأعمدة يتم استخدامه لتوليد القيم الأساسية تلقائيًا بناءً على البداية المقدمة (نقطة البداية) والزيادة. خادم قاعدة البيانات يزودنا بعدد من الوظائف التي تعمل مع هوية عمودي. في هذه النصيحة ، سنتناول هذه الوظائف بأمثلة.
أيضًا ، ما هو أمر DML الذي يتم استخدامه معIdentity في SQL؟ عند استخدام عبارة INSERT لإدراج البيانات في جدول بامتداد هوية العمود المحدد ، SQL سيرفر الخادم ملف هوية القيمة. يمكنك استعمال ال @@هوية متغير ووظائف SCOPE_IDENTITY و IDENT_CURRENT لإرجاع الأخير هوية القيمة التي تم إنشاؤها بواسطة SQL الخادم.
فيما يتعلق بهذا ، ما هوفي SQL؟
في SQL الخادم ، الرمز @@ مسبوقة بالمتغيرات العامة. يحتفظ الخادم بجميع المتغيرات العالمية. تبدأ أسماء المتغيرات العامة بـ @@ اختصار. لا تحتاج إلى التصريح عنها ، لأن الخادم يقوم بصيانتها باستمرار. إنها وظائف معرّفة من قبل النظام ولا يمكنك التصريح عنها.
هل عمود الهوية مفتاح أساسي؟
أعمدة الهوية و المفاتيح الأساسية شيئان مميزان للغاية. ان عمود الهوية يوفر رقمًا يتزايد تلقائيًا. هذا كل ما يفعله. ال المفتاح الأساسي (على الأقل في SQL Server) هو قيد فريد يضمن التفرد وهو عادةً (ولكن ليس دائمًا) مجمع مفتاح.
موصى به:
كيف يمكنني تشغيل كتلة PL SQL في مطور SQL؟
بافتراض أن لديك اتصالًا تم تكوينه بالفعل في مطور SQL: من القائمة عرض ، حدد إخراج DBMS. في نافذة إخراج DBMS ، انقر فوق رمز الجمع الأخضر ، وحدد الاتصال الخاص بك. انقر بزر الماوس الأيمن فوق الاتصال واختر ورقة عمل SQL. الصق الاستعلام الخاص بك في ورقة العمل. قم بتشغيل الاستعلام
كيف يمكنني تشغيل استعلام SQL في SQL Server Management Studio؟
تشغيل استعلام في جزء مستكشف الكائنات ، قم بتوسيع عقدة خادم المستوى الأعلى ثم قواعد البيانات. انقر بزر الماوس الأيمن فوق قاعدة بيانات vCommander واختر استعلام جديد. انسخ الاستعلام الخاص بك في جزء الاستعلام الجديد الذي يفتح. انقر فوق تنفيذ
كيف تختلف PL SQL عن SQL؟
PL / SQL هي لغة إجرائية وهي امتداد لـ SQL ، وهي تحتفظ بعبارات SQL داخل بنائها. يتمثل الاختلاف الأساسي بين SQL وPL / SQL في أنه في SQL يتم تنفيذ استعلام واحد في وقت واحد ، بينما في PL / SQL يتم تنفيذ كود blockof كامل في وقت واحد
هل SQL هو نفسه SQL Server؟
الإجابة: يتمثل الاختلاف الرئيسي بين SQL و MSSQL في أن SQL هي لغة استعلام تُستخدم في قواعد بيانات العلاقة بينما MS SQL Server هو نفسه نظام إدارة قواعد البيانات العلائقية (RDBMS) الذي طورته Microsoft. تستخدم معظم أنظمة RDBMS التجارية SQL للتفاعل مع قاعدة البيانات
هل SQL و SQL Server متشابهان؟
الإجابة: يتمثل الاختلاف الرئيسي بين SQL و MS SQL في أن SQL هي لغة استعلام تُستخدم في قواعد بيانات العلاقات بينما MS SQL Server هو نفسه نظام إدارة قواعد بيانات علائقية (RDBMS) طورته Microsoft. RDBMS هو نظام لإدارة قواعد البيانات بهيكل جدول قائم على الصفوف